Jonathan Haggerty reveals the former UFC champion he’d love to face in a mixed-rules fight

Although Jonathan Haggerty has already conquered the worlds of Muay Thai and Kickboxing, he would like to challenge himself even further and take a UFC star in a showdown with mixed rules.

On February 20, the Englishman will return to action in his long-awaited comeback fight at one 171 championship in the Lusail Sports Arena in Qatar.

In a competition that looks destined to excite, Haggerty will put his Bantamweight Kickboxing World Championship on the line against Wei Rui.

And if he emerges undamaged from the game, then there are several paths that could go down the talented striker.

Jonathan Haggerty wants Sean O'Malley in a fight with mixed rules

Blessed with a thunderous downward elbow and devastating stairs, Jonathan Haggerty has proven as one of the best pound-for-pound Muay Thai practitioners on the planet.

And because his father fought in MMA during his own sporty Prime, the Londoner has taught the fundamental gripping skills needed to compete in the discipline.

Back on one x, Demetrious Johnson and Rodtang Jitmuangnon collided in a truly epic encounter, in which they did a round of Muay Thai before switching to MMA in the second segment.

In an exciting opener unleashed the Thai thunderous shots, with 'Mighty Mouse' that had to ride the storm before he would close the show with a followed show, as soon as the game came in.

After viewing the entertaining spectacle, Haggerty would like to put his skills to the test in a similar fight.

In an exclusive interview with Bloody Elbow, he exclaimed: “100%, I am a hunter – I am everything for. If it makes sense, I am definitely for it. If there is a challenge, then I am a challenge. That would certainly be great to do. '

When asked for his dream -opponent, he only had two names: “Fabricio Andrade [and] Sean O'Malley. '
